209001 - 四色地图

四色定理是:“任何一张地图只用四种颜色就能使具有共同边界的国家着上不同的颜色。”

如图所示,给出一任意地图,试用四种颜色涂色,使相邻区域不能有相同颜色。

输入

第一行为N(1<N\le26),表示区域数。随后N行描述各区域之间是否相邻。

输出

以1,2,3,4分别代表四种颜色,输出各区域的编号(最小字典序)。

样例

输入

4
1 2 3 (表示区域1与区域2,3相邻,以下3行同理)
2 1 4
3 1 4
4 3 2 

输出

1 2 2 1(表示分别编号即颜色为1,2,2,1)

输入

4
1 2 3
2 1 4
3 1 4
4 3 2 

输出

1 2 2 1
时间限制 1 秒
内存限制 128 MB
讨论 统计
上一题 下一题